If Spooner was riding high fresh off their 11-2 takedown of Northwestern on Thursday, their most recent game may have dampened their spirits a bit. The Rails fell just short of the St. Croix Falls Saints by a score of 6-5 on Friday. The game marked the Rails' lowest-scoring contest so far this season.

Layla Thompson and Annalie Lindgren did some serious damage despite the final result: Thompson went 3-for-4 with two stolen bases and one run, while Lindgren went 3-for-4 with one stolen base, one run, and one double. Thompson is crushing it when it comes to stolen bases: she's snagged at least one every time she's taken the field this season. Alaska Johnson also deserves some recognition as she hit her first triple of the season.
Spooner's defeat dropped their record down to 10-1. As for St. Croix Falls, they pushed their record up to 8-6 with the victory, which was their fifth straight at home.
Coming up, Spooner will host Hayward at 5:00 p.m. on Monday. As for St. Croix Falls, they wasted no time getting back out on the field and have already played their next matchup, a 2-1 loss against Northwood/Solon Springs on the 9th.
